2. Key Differences Analysis

Apple iPhone 12 Pro Max Advantages:

  • Superior Performance: The A14 Bionic chipset offers significantly faster processing and graphics performance. This will translate to smoother multitasking, faster app loading, and better gaming experiences.
  • Higher Quality Display: Higher resolution and pixel density offer a sharper and more detailed visual experience, better for media consumption and reading.
  • Better Camera System: Offers a telephoto lens with optical zoom, leading to more versatility in zoom shots and better overall photo quality as proven by DxOMark tests. The main camera also has a wider aperture for better low-light performance.
  • Brighter Display: Offers better readability in bright, outdoor conditions.
  • Stereo Speakers: Provides better audio for media consumption than mono speakers.
  • Build Quality: While screen protection is unspecified, Apple is known for higher build quality, with premium materials like stainless steel.
  • eSIM support: The user has access to a second sim using the eSIM format, allowing for greater flexibility when switching carriers.

Samsung Galaxy A52 5G Advantages:

  • Smoother Display: 120Hz refresh rate offers a significantly smoother scrolling and animation experience for a more fluid-feeling device.
  • Larger Battery: The 4500mAh battery will likely provide longer battery life than the iPhone's 3687mAh battery.
  • Faster Charging: 25W fast charging allows for slightly faster charging times.
  • More Versatile Camera: While the main camera might be less capable than the iPhone, the A52 5G provides a macro lens, a depth sensor for portraits, and a higher resolution selfie camera for additional versatility.
  • Fingerprint Sensor: Provides more accessible biometric security through a physical fingerprint scanner.
  • Lighter Design: Easier to carry for extended periods, making it more pocketable.
  • Screen Protection: Uses Corning Gorilla Glass 5 for better scratch resistance.
  • More RAM: The optional 8GB of RAM allows for greater multitasking capabilities.

Trade-offs:

  • iPhone 12 Pro Max: Lacks the smooth 120Hz display, and has a smaller battery, as well as lower charging speeds. Its higher price may be a barrier to entry.
  • Samsung Galaxy A52 5G: Trades raw processing power and a high-end camera system for more practical everyday features. The phone does not include brightness specifications, which can imply a lack of quality when in use outdoors.
